Blonde Ambition Blue Grama Grass is an exceptional choice for any garden, showcasing its upright chartreuse seed heads that transform into a stunning blond hue as they mature. This grass gracefully sways above its fine-textured blue-green foliage from mid-summer through fall, making it a captivating addition to your landscape. This resilient native grass thrives in USDA zones 4–9, adding captivating drama and rich texture to modern landscapes, xeriscapes, and containers. It's an excellent choice for any gardener looking to enhance their outdoor spaces. The seed heads gracefully float horizontally on tall stems, resembling tiny flags and providing a striking architectural presence in your garden. The foliage showcases a stunning blue-green hue that captivates throughout the growing season, transitioning to a gentle tan in winter, ensuring your garden remains visually appealing all year long. While it may not be widely recognized for its aroma, the seed heads release a subtle earthy fragrance when dried, adding a unique touch to your garden experience. Blonde Ambition flourishes in full sun and well-drained soil, making it an ideal choice for mass plantings, borders, or as a stunning centerpiece in patio containers. This plant offers the perfect solution for your garden, being resistant to deer and tolerant of drought once it's established. Plus, it's safe for pets, ensuring a worry-free environment for your beloved dogs and cats. Although it may not attract pollinators as strongly as certain flowering plants, it offers significant habitat benefits for birds and small insects, making it a valuable addition to any garden.
This ornamental grass is a breeze to cultivate, requires minimal upkeep, and stands out as a fantastic option for sustainable landscaping. For the best results, consider planting it in spring or early fall, ensuring it receives plenty of sunlight and is placed in well-draining soil. Ensure you water consistently during the initial growing season to promote a robust root system, and once it's well-established, you can cut back on watering. Enhance your garden's health by applying a layer of mulch to effectively retain soil moisture and suppress those pesky weeds. Just remember to keep it from piling directly against the base for optimal results. Consider pruning back old foliage in late winter to early spring; this simple action can lead to vibrant new growth in your garden. While fertilizing may not always be essential, consider giving your plants a gentle boost with a light feeding of balanced, slow-release fertilizer in early spring. It can make a significant difference in their growth and vitality.
